What is Meatloaf?
Table of Contents
Meatloaf is a dish made from ground meat mixed with other ingredients and formed into a loaf shape, then baked or smoked. The final dish can vary widely in texture and flavor, but most versions include ground beef, bread crumbs or oats, eggs, onion, ketchup or tomato sauce, and spices.
While the origins of meatloaf are unclear, it is thought to date back to ancient Rome where it was known as Isicia Omentata. This dish consisted of ground meat (usually pork) mixed with spices and formed into a loaf, then grilled or baked. The addition of bread crumbs or oats is thought to have come later, most likely as a way to stretch the ground meat and make it go further.
In the United States, meatloaf has long been a comfort food favorite. It is often served with mashed potatoes and gravy, or simply ketchup on top. It can be made ahead of time and reheated, making it a convenient meal for busy weeknights. And leftovers (if you’re lucky enough to have any!) make great sandwiches the next day.
How to Make Meatloaf?
To make meatloaf It’s actually quite simple. Start with 2 pounds of ground beef (you can also use ground turkey, chicken, pork, lamb, or a mix). Add 1 cup of bread crumbs or oats, 1 egg, 1 onion, chopped, 1/2 cup ketchup or tomato sauce, and 1 teaspoon of salt. Mix everything together with your hands until well combined.
Preheat your oven to 375 degrees Fahrenheit. Line a baking dish with foil or parchment paper, then form the meat mixture into a loaf shape. Bake for 45 to 60 minutes, or until the internal temperature reaches 160 degrees Fahrenheit. Let the meatloaf rest for 10 minutes before slicing and serving.

How Long to Cook Meatloaf at 375 Degrees?
If you wanna to know about times that you spent in cooking meatloaf, you have to read the following important article about how long to cook meatloaf at 375 F.
How long to cook 2 lb meatloaf at 375 degrees? For a 2 pound meatloaf, you should cook it for about 1 hour and 15 minutes. If your meatloaf is on the smaller side, around 1 pound, you can reduce the cooking time to about 45 minutes.
It’s best to use a meat thermometer to check the internal temperature of the meatloaf, so you don’t have to worry about overcooking or undercooking it. To get an accurate reading, insert the thermometer into the center of the meatloaf.
Once the meatloaf has reached 160 degrees, remove it from the oven and let it rest for about 5-10 minutes before slicing and serving. This will allow the juices to redistribute throughout the meatloaf, making it even more juicy and delicious!

One of the most important things to keep in mind when making meatloaf is to not overmix the meat. Overmixing will result in a tough, dry meatloaf. So, when you add the ground beef to the bowl, mix it just until it’s combined with the other ingredients. Then, use your hands to gently mix everything together until it’s just combined.
Another tip for making meatloaf is to add a binder. This will help to keep your meatloaf together and prevent it from falling apart. A couple of good options for binders are cracker crumbs or bread crumbs. Simply add 1/2 cup to the mixture and mix until combined.

How To Store Meatloaf
If you have leftover meatloaf, don’t worry – it can be stored in the fridge or freezer and enjoyed at a later date. Here are some tips on how to store meatloaf so that it stays fresh and delicious.
First, if you plan to eat the meatloaf within a few days, store it in the fridge. Place the meatloaf in an airtight container or wrap it tightly in aluminum foil or plastic wrap. It will stay fresh in the fridge for up to four days.
If you want to keep the meatloaf for longer, freezing is the way to go. Wrap the meatloaf tightly in aluminum foil or plastic wrap, then place it in a freezer bag. Label the bag with the date and contents, and then store it in the freezer for up to three months. When you’re ready to eat it, thaw the meatloaf in the fridge overnight, then reheat it in the oven or microwave.
How to reheat Meatloaf
There are some ways that you can reheat your meatloaf. You can either heat it up in the oven, on the stove, or in the microwave. If you’re reheating your meatloaf in the oven, you’ll want to preheat your oven to 375 degrees Fahrenheit. Then, place your meatloaf on a baking sheet and put it in the oven. Cook for about 15-20 minutes, or until the meatloaf is heated all the way through.
If you’re reheating your meatloaf on the stove, you’ll want to put it in a pan over medium heat. Cook for about 10 minutes, or until the meatloaf is heated all the way through.
If you’re reheating your meatloaf in the microwave, you’ll want to place it on a microwave-safe plate. Cook for about 2-3 minutes, or until the meatloaf is heated all the way through.
Common Mistakes To Avoid When Cook Meatloaf in an Oven at 375
Cooking meatloaf is a simple process, but there are a few common mistakes that can ruin your dish.
Here are four mistakes to avoid when cooking meatloaf at 375 degrees in an oven:
Not Preheating the Oven: This is one of the most common mistakes when cooking any type of food in an oven. Always make sure to preheat the oven to the desired temperature before cooking. Otherwise, your meatloaf will not cook evenly and could end up overcooked or undercooked.
Not Adding Enough Fat: Another common mistake is not adding enough fat to the meatloaf mix. This can cause the meatloaf to be dry and crumbly. Add at least 1/4 cup of fat (such as olive oil, melted butter, or bacon grease) to the mix to ensure a moist and flavorful meatloaf.
Overcooking the Meatloaf: It’s important to cook the meatloaf until it’s just done, otherwise it will be dry and tough. Use a digital thermometer to check the internal temperature of the meatloaf; it should be between 160-170 degrees Fahrenheit.
Not Letting the Meatloaf Rest: It’s tempting to slice into the meatloaf as soon as it comes out of the oven, but it’s important to let it rest for at least 10 minutes. This allows the juices to redistribute, making for a more moist and flavorful meatloaf.

FAQs about How Long to Cook Meatloaf at 375
Assuming you are cooking one meatloaf, here are some FAQs about how long to cook meatloaf at 375 degrees:
Q: What is the cook time for 3 lb meatloaf at 375 degrees?
A: The cook time for 3 lb meatloaf at 375 degrees is approximately 1 ½ hours.
Q: What is the internal temperature that the meatloaf should reach?
A: If you are using a meat thermometer, the internal temperature of the meatloaf should reach 160 degrees.
Q: Will the cook time be different if I am cooking multiple meatloaves?
A: The cook time may be slightly different if you are cooking multiple meatloaves. We recommend checking the meatloaves periodically to ensure they are cooked through.
